Veteran Pacer Bhuvneshwar Kumar Expresses Frustration Over Non-Selection in Team India
Veteran Team India pacer Bhuvneshwar Kumar has recently voiced his frustration over being left out of the national cricket team. Despite his consistent performances, Kumar has not been given the opportunity to represent India in T20 Internationals since November 2022. The right-arm pacer, who is the fourth-highest wicket-taker for Team India in T20Is, has secured 90 wickets in 87 matches at an average of 23.10 and a strike rate of 6.96, including impressive bowling performances with two five-wicket hauls and three four-wicket hauls.
Only the Selectors Can Provide Answers
When asked about a potential comeback to the Indian cricket team, Bhuvneshwar Kumar emphasized that only the selectors, led by Ajit Agarkar, could answer that question. The 35-year-old pacer stated, “Aapko iska uttar chayanakarta denge (Only the selectors can answer that).” Despite the uncertainty surrounding his selection, Kumar remains focused on delivering his best on the field and has pledged to continue giving his all in domestic competitions.

Bhuvneshwar Kumar’s Impact in IPL 2025
While Bhuvneshwar Kumar faced challenges in the T20 World Cup campaign in Australia, where he struggled to make a significant impact with the ball, he played a pivotal role in Royal Challengers Bengaluru’s victory in IPL 2025. Kumar secured 17 wickets in 14 matches at an average of 28.41 and an economy rate of 9.28, including a crucial 2-38 performance in the final against Punjab Kings (PBKS).
Overall, Bhuvneshwar Kumar is the second-highest wicket-taker in IPL history with 198 wickets in 190 matches, trailing only Yuzvendra Chahal. Currently leading the Lucknow Falcons in the UP T20 League, Kumar continues to showcase his skills and determination on the field, hoping for an opportunity to represent Team India once again.
